What this means

Status 710 means the registration was cancelled because a required Section 8 declaration of continued use was not filed within the deadline (including any grace period). The federal registration is no longer active. Evaluate filing a new application if you still use the mark, or petition if cancellation was erroneous. Consult counsel on remaining common-law rights.

Goods and services

ClassDescriptionStatusFirst use
007Internal combustion engine parts, namely, valves; valve train components consisting of lifters, return springs, and roller arms; cam shaft housings; rocker arms; rocker arm assemblies consisting of connecting rods and return springs; roller rocker arms; roller followers and valve guidesSECTION 8 - CANCELLEDNov 30, 2002
